The Young Ambassadors of Virtue Foundation, in cooperation with the Sirindhorn International Environmental Park Foundation, organized an “Energy Conservation” camp. The camp was held at Sirindhorn International Environment Park, Petchaburi Province between 27 – 29 October 2014. The participants comprised 63 Young Ambassadors of Virtue and 12 teachers, representing 22 schools from 12 provinces in Thailand.

The activities at the camp included viewing of an exhibition in honor of His Majesty on energy conservation, value of energy, methods to conserve energy, and available technologies that can support energy conservation, with a view to promote ways of life that are in harmony with nature. Participants also had a chance to learn means to conserve natural resources, especially the means to conserve mangrove forest in accordance with His Majesty’s initiative.

After having completed this learning experience, 5 Young Ambassadors of Virtue and 1 teacher were selected to join the study trip to Indonesia in February 2015 to promote knowledge exchanges and friendship.

The Young Ambassadors of Virtue Foundation and Office of the Royal Development Projects Board (ORDPB) organized a camp on The King’s Philosophy to Sustainable Development

The Young Ambassadors of Virtue Foundation, in cooperation with Office of the Royal Development Projects Board (ORDPB), arranged a camp called “The King’s Philosophy to Sustainable Development” at Phu Phan Royal Development Study Centre in Sakon Nakhon province during 5 – 9 May 2018. The camp was participated by 139 Young Ambassadors of Virtue and 32 teachers representing 52 schools from 17 provinces all over Thailand.
